Onboarding note for the Ledgerpane admin table: bulk edits are applied through the batcher service, not directly against the database. Select rows, choose an action, and the batcher stages changes in a pending set you can review before commit. Edits over 500 rows require a second approver — this is enforced server-side, so don't try to chunk around it. To run the batcher locally you need the staging write credential, which goes in your .env as the next line.

secret setting of bahip-kagag: RELAY_SECRET3=c83

# Break-Glass: Catalog Cache Invalidation

Scope: the Pinrow product catalog at Veldstone Retail. If stale prices persist after a purge and the Hollowmere invalidation queue is wedged, use break-glass to flush the edge tier directly. Contractors: get verbal sign-off from the catalog lead first. Steps: open the Hollowmere admin shell, select emergency-flush, confirm the tenant, and run it once — repeated flushes thrash the origin. Access is logged and expires after 20 minutes. Unseal the admin shell with the passphrase below.

recovery phrase for kahop-tajog: istix-casvan

Minutes — Management Meeting, Pricing Review

Attendees: Torv Askel, Pria Lendon, Max Querido. The committee approved a 9% price increase for legacy Cindermill subscribers, effective next renewal cycle. Notifications go out sixty days ahead; retention offers are limited to accounts flagged by Pria's team. Support tiers remain unchanged. For the incoming director, the confidential rationale is recorded below.

internal memo for faweg-tafog: Only 7 of the 100 pilot accounts renewed Quenael, so a churn review is set for April 15.

# Getting into the Prototype Workshop

Welcome aboard! The workshop on the ground floor of the Kestrel Building is where the Fenwick team builds early hardware mock-ups — and yes, you'll probably end up there in your first week. A few rules: closed shoes only, no food near the benches, and always let the workshop lead, Dara Holm, know you're coming. Once you've done the ten-minute safety briefing, you're cleared to go in. Punch in the door code below.

door code, yagap-bahof: bdg-O-05